Gerbino lived and worked in the small French commune of Vallauris just north of Antibes and Cannes, a town known since Roman times as a center of pottery. By the mid 20th century, Vallauris came to be called “the city of 100 potters,” and boasted residents such as Picasso, who came there to create his own sculptural and ceramic works. Gerbino moved to Vallauris in 1902 to work for other master potters while honing his own “Gerbino” method. By 1930 until his death in 1966, he had his own studio there, in which he produced his signature mosaic pieces, made from stacking slabs of colored clay, rather than relying on surface glazes. His technique is similar to more traditional \u003ci\u003eterre mêlée\u003c\/i\u003e practices and also takes a cue from Japanese \u003ci\u003eneriage\u003c\/i\u003e, a form of pottery that also relies on colored clay slabs to achieve intricate designs.
